It is most typical for a resort to be connected with just one of the larger exchange companies, although resorts with double associations are not unusual. The timeshare resort one purchases figures out which of the exchange business can be used to make exchanges. RCI and II charge a yearly subscription cost, and extra costs for when they find an exchange for an asking for member, and bar members from leasing weeks for which they currently have exchanged.
Owners can exchange without requiring the turn to have a formal affiliation arrangement with the companies, if the resort of ownership concurs to such plans in the original contract. Due to the guarantee of exchange, timeshares typically sell regardless of the area of their deeded resort. What is not typically disclosed is the distinction in trading power depending upon the place, and season of the ownership.
However, timeshares in highly preferable places and high season time slots are the most costly worldwide, based on demand normal of any heavily trafficked getaway area. A person who owns a timeshare in the American desert community of Palm Springs, California in the middle of July or August will possess a much minimized capability to exchange time, due to the fact that less pertained to a resort at a time when the temperature levels are in excess of 110 F (43 C).
With deeded agreements using the resort is normally divided into week-long increments and are offered as real estate by means of fractional ownership. Similar to any other piece of realty, the owner may do whatever is wanted: utilize the week, lease it, provide it away, leave it to heirs, or sell the week to another prospective purchaser.
The owner can possibly deduct some property-related Get more info expenses, such as property tax from taxable earnings. Deeded ownership can be as complex as straight-out residential or commercial property ownership in that the structure of deeds differ according to regional home laws. Leasehold deeds are typical and offer ownership for a set time period after which the ownership reverts to the freeholder.

With right-to-use agreements, a buyer has the right to use the property in accordance with the contract, however at some point the contract ends and all rights go back to the homeowner. Thus, a right-to-use contract grants the right to use the resort for a specific variety of years. In lots of nations there are severe limits on foreign property ownership; therefore, this is a typical method for establishing resorts in nations such as Mexico.
The https://www.sunshinekelly.com/2020/07/all-you-need-to-know-about-timeshares.html right to utilize may be lost with the demise of the managing business, because a right to utilize purchaser's agreement is typically only excellent with the present owner, and if that owner sells the home, the lease holder might be out of luck depending on the structure of the contract, and/or present laws in foreign venues.
An owner might own a deed to utilize a system for a single specified week; for instance, week 51 typically includes Christmas. A person who owns Week 26 at a resort can use only that week in each year. In some cases units are sold as drifting weeks, in which an agreement defines the variety of weeks held by each owner and from which weeks the owner may choose for his stay.
In such a circumstance, there is likely to be higher competition throughout weeks including holidays, while lower competitors is likely when schools are still in session. Some drifting agreements omit significant vacations so they may be sold as repaired weeks. Some are offered as turning weeks, typically referred to as flex weeks.
This method offers each owner a reasonable opportunity for prime weeks, however unlike its name, it is not flexible. Resort-based points programs are likewise sold as deeded and as ideal to utilize. Points programs annually give the owner a variety of points equal to the level of ownership. The owner in a points program can then use these points to make travel arrangements within the resort group. Numerous points programs are affiliated with big resort groups using a large choice of options for location.
Resort point program members, such as WorldMark by Wyndham and Diamond Resorts International, may ask for from the whole readily available stock of the resort group. A points program member may typically request fractional weeks in addition to full or numerous week stays. The variety of points needed to remain at the resort in question will differ based upon a points chart.
